The Mizuno T24 are forged from a single block of carbon steel with boron alloy in Hiroshima, Japan. This material offers an exceptionally soft feel on ball contact while providing longer groove durability for precise contact. The new design allowed thinning the top line for a sportier look and greater confidence at address. Despite the visually smaller head shape, the T24 model offers higher forgiveness and consistency than the previous T22 thanks to new weighting. Due to the thinner top line, your chips will be lower, but the ball will have more spin for excellent control over the impact. Even if you hit the ball higher on the impact face, your chips will confidently stop better.
The improved groove shape ensures enough spin and cleaner contact with the ball both on full shots and shorter swings. Wedge with lofts from 46° to 52° have 17 grooves with a narrower profile for higher stability on full shots, while wedges from 54° to 60° have 15 grooves with a wider profile for optimal shot control on shorter swings. The entire impact face is treated with unique HydroFlow technology, which prevents spin reduction due to moisture.
Which sole shape to choose?
S - higher bounce. For full shots, universal sole shape.
D - medium bounce. For full shots, universal sole shape with easier playability with an open face.
C - medium or higher bounce. For players who like to experiment with different open face positions. Universal sole for bunker, rough, and fairway play.
V - high bounce. For players with a steeper swing who demand maximum versatility from their wedges.
X - low bounce. For players with a shallow swing who demand maximum versatility from their wedges.
